35.233 - Banana daiquiri

23 years old, distilled 27th October 1995, 53.0% abv, First Fill Ex-Bourbon Barrel, 191 bottles, dram price F

SMWS 35.233 - Banana daiquiriThe nose has strawberry, banana, marzipan and hints of spiced rum. The mouthfeel is thin with no cling. The body has strawberry, banana, glace cherries, sultanas and plenty of vanilla, before moving towards cinnamon and horseradish towards the finish. The finish is banana, cinnamon and horseradish. (The horseradish builds on repeated sipping, which I find... challenging.)

Water brings out thick whorling that rapidly expands and quickly settles into thin mottling. The nose gains peppermint and loses the strawberry. The body gains peppermint and vanilla, and loses the strawberries and glace cherries. The finish gains more vanilla and some horseradish.

I like everything about this dram but the horseradish, which is a little overpowering. But for those with a tolerance of hot foods, this will be a delightful dram - packed with nicely balanced flavour.

One for summer evenings.
